received 231524173932813
received 1615291712088791
received 2071432583137346
received 1400225563342162
received 10156942878908289
received 260523471099410
received 1026729790692454
received 1022938594461786
received 761876267277571
received 1843084255927666
received 585288401651793
received 1889726878006418
received 199721670564779
received 993785637393852
received 854449687920758
received 1105526932807396
received 10215110227740047
received 152482658447114
received 1481963258505928
received 10209020432369938